The top 10 burgers in Scarborough

Scarborough is home to some truly excellent burgers that could totally fill up an episode of Diners, Drive-ins & Dives. From nostalgic institutions to big halal burger chains, you'll find flame-licked beef patties throughout this borough that'll make your mouth water.

Here are my picks for the top burgers in Scarborough.

Mama's Boys Burgers

This family-run diner dishes out delicious char-grilled singles or doubles on a bun. Mama's Signature is a showstopper featuring beef patties with crispy, bubbly cheese dressed with bacon, caramelized onions and your choice of fresh toppings from the counter.

The Real McCoy

This institution has been in business for decades and has earned a loyal following for its big, beefy eight-ounce MOJO burger piled with American cheese and bacon. You can add on the standard array of toppings including, ketchup, mustard, mayo, lettuce, tomatoes and pickles by request.

Johnny's Hamburgers

Here's another Scarborough institution that hasn't changed a bit. Hamburgers are charcoal-grilled and toppings are applied to order and include a line-up of standards. There's relish, mustard, ketchup, tomatoes, pickles and onions, both raw and sauteed. 

Harry's Drive In

This retro drive-in serves up a nostalgic menu featuring hamburgers, cheese dogs, gyros and steak on a kaiser. Locals may argue that Johnny's is better, but you can't go wrong with either.

Top Gun Burgers

If you're looking for an over-the-top burger joint in Scarborough, look no further than this halal burger chain. They stack their burgers high and top them with waterfalls of melting cheese.

The Burger Alley

Top Gun Burgers isn't the only Scarborough joint for epic and over the top halal burgers. This spot on Lebovic is dishing out burgers topped with everything from Buffalo chicken strips to herb-crusted portabello mushrooms and even runny fried eggs.

Shamrock Burgers

This burger joint has been kicking it old-school since 1970. It covers your basic burger cravings and also features more extreme options. There's a double-decker grilled cheeseburger in addition to the Canadiana with bacon, peameal, poutine and pulled pork.

Mini Moe's

The Juicy Lucy is probably the most famous menu item from this burger shop on Lawrence. Instead of your typical cheeseburger, this beef patty has a hunk of cheese at its core that oozes out as you eat it.

Gingerman Restaurant

The classic old school dinner is doing a take on classic burger served with fries and a little coleslaw and pickle. The no-frills burger is homemade and juicy.

Kathy's Grill

While this restaurant may be known for their tasty Greek fare don't pass up the chance to sink your teeth into charcoal-grilled homemade burgers. If you're feeling really hungry get the double.
